The project is located in the Indian city of Ahmedabad. It houses the munici-

pal organization, Ahmedabad Heritage Center, dedicated to the restoration

and rehabilitation of historic heritage buildings.

By using a 6x6 structural grid and staggered platforms, the building o�ers a

continuous space which can house a single use, as a conference room, but

the same space can also be divided through mobile elements to house di�er-

ents uses. These elements not only distribute the space, but also allows us to

adapt the space to di�erent light and shadow needs.

Like the Indian vernacular Architecture, The building program is organized

depending on the lighting, the function of each space is determined by the

amount of light it receives. The building is divided into, Protected Areas; they

o�er a controlled and quite environment. This part houses the permanent

program, such as the o�ces. Intermediate Areas, these areas are protected from

the light and the rain, but are exposed to the street noise. This part is occupied

by permanent uses related to public users. Exposed Areas, these areas allows us

the �exibility required for the diversity of uses.

Construction Details

The supporting structure is designed as an evolution of the same structural

concept. Elements or volumes are attached to a vertical support leaving the

ground �oor free of columns. The structure is made of laminated bamboo

beams and pillars, with simple joints that allows a seriable construction.

The mobile panels, supported on the

umbrella shaped structure, are also made

of bamboo slats. They can be put in

motion by a balances and pulley mecha-

nism that is activated manually.

The O�ces need of a greater insulation from the outside is solved by the use

of a double façade system. The outer enclosure consist of a porous timber

façade to �lter the light and noise, while y the inner bamboo and glass façade

protect from the rain water.

The model not only represent the Project structure, It was made to maximize

the possibilities o�ered by the toll to use, the laser cutting machine in this case.

The model was build up without glue, �tting pieces together thanks to little

grooves placed on their bottom or upper parts. Thanks to this, a faultless and

detailed architecture model was obtained.

The building is adapted not only to the material availability of the site, but also

to the Indian weather extreme conditions. The building distribution and the

façades were thought to allow a passive refrigeration system. An ecological

water system was introduced to solve the water scarcity, this ecological water

system includes a system to collect the rain water in tanks, so it can be used

along the whole year, and a sewage treatment system, which clean the water

through the use of a particular kind of plant.

The project is placed in the Moroccan city of Casablanca, on the Hay Moham-

madi lively neighbourhood. The building includes cultural facilities (associated

with the Spanish Instituto Cervantes) and a local market to replace the actual,

non-funcional, one. The neighborhood where the project is placed was a well

known architecture international project made by Michel Ecochard in the 50's.

Actually the white houses of the modern movement have been transformed

through the time, growing in heigh by unstable constructions .

The project works as a concrete skeleton, which is temporally occupied by food

stalls and clothes shops. These heavy structure gives shadows and allows the

passive ventilation. In contrast to this 3 floor building, we find the vertical

construction of the tower, whose façade is made of metalic mesh, giving it

transparency and lightness.
